Encellin, a personalized regenerative medicine biotech company developing novel cell-based approaches to deliver sustained therapies with a single implant, today announced the closing of a $5.9M Seed financing round. The round was co-led by Khosla Ventures and SV Latam Capital, with participation from Sandhill Angels and Y Combinator.

Encellin is developing regenerative materials using cell transplant therapy. The company has developed cell transplant therapy for treating missing, damaged, or diseased cells and treatment of chronic diseases beginning with hypoglycemia and hypocalcemia. Its soft cell encapsulation device (CED) functions like a pouch to hold cells and help these cells survive in the body. Encellin’s CED allows enclosed cells to function like smart molecular factories, releasing therapeutics when needed. The founding team from the University of California San Francisco (UCSF) leads the way in nano-technology and bioengineering. The company is headquarted in San Francisco, CA.
